#!/usr/bin/python
# This Source Code Form is subject to the terms of the Mozilla Public
# License, v. 2.0. If a copy of the MPL was not distributed with this
# file, You can obtain one at http://mozilla.org/MPL/2.0/.
# Copyright (c) 2014 Mozilla Corporation
#
# Contributors:
# Jeff Bryner [email protected]/[email protected]
# Lerit Nuksawn [email protected]
#
# Parser for rabbitmq .rdq files that attempts
# to find record delimeters, record length and
# output json of the record
# Assumes your rabbitmq events are json.
# example run: ./rdqdump.py -f 383506.rdq -c0 | less
#
#
import os
import sys
import io
from argparse import ArgumentParser
import json
import yaml
from helpers.rabbitmq import RabbitMQ
from helpers.hex import hexdump, convert_hex
def read_chunk(data, start, end):
data.seek(int(start))
readdata = data.read(end)
return readdata
def save_data(output_file, queue_name, queue_message, file_location='output'):
try:
queue_message = json.loads(queue_message)
except:
pass
line = {
'queue_name': queue_name,
'queue_message': queue_message
}
file_location = file_location.rstrip('/')
with open(f'{file_location}/{output_file}', 'a') as out_file:
out_file.write(json.dumps(line) + '\n')
def extract_unescaped_content(src, data, hex_bytes, chunk_size, data_length_byte_size, zero=False):
# where is the string in this chunk of data
hexdata = convert_hex(data)
data_pos = hexdata.find(hex_bytes.upper()) / 2
# where is the string in the file
data_address = (max(0, (src.tell() - chunk_size)) + data_pos)
# what do we print in the hexoutput
print_address = data_address
if zero:
# used to carve out a portion of a stream and save it via xxd -r
print_address = 0
# Find the length of the data
record_size = read_chunk(src, data_address + len(hex_bytes) / 2, data_length_byte_size)
rdq_entry_length = int(convert_hex(record_size), 16)
data = read_chunk(src, data_address + (len(hex_bytes) / 2) + data_length_byte_size, rdq_entry_length)
unescaped_data = data.decode('ascii', 'ignore')
if options.debug:
print(hexdump(data, byte_separator='', group_size=2, group_separator=' ', printable_separator=' ', address=print_address, line_size=16, address_format='%f'))
return (data, unescaped_data)
def restore_rdq_data(
file_path,
queue_name_indicator_hex,
queue_message_indicator_hex,
chunk,
message_limit,
output_file,
queue,
start_bytes=0,
delete_file=False,
debug=False,
dev_debug=False,
zero=False
):
print(f"Start processing '{file_path}'")
src, chunk_size = read_file(file_path, chunk)
if debug:
print("[*] position: %d" % (src.tell()))
count = 0
queue_name = None
queue_message = None
data = read_chunk(src, start_bytes, chunk_size)
while data:
if dev_debug:
print("Data:")
print(data)
print("")
print("Data (HEX):")
print(convert_hex(data))
print("")
for hex_bytes in queue_name_indicator_hex:
if len(hex_bytes) > 0 and hex_bytes.upper() in convert_hex(data):
if queue_name is not None:
raise Exception(f"ERROR [1], QUEUE MESSAGE NOT FOUND FOR QUEUE NAME ({hex_bytes})")
(data, queue_name) = extract_unescaped_content(
src=src,
data=data,
hex_bytes=hex_bytes,
chunk_size=chunk_size,
data_length_byte_size=1,
zero=zero
)
for hex_bytes in queue_message_indicator_hex:
if len(hex_bytes) > 0 and hex_bytes.upper() in convert_hex(data):
if queue_message is not None:
raise Exception("ERROR [2], QUEUE NAME NOT FOUND FOR QUEUE MESSAGE")
(data, queue_message) = extract_unescaped_content(
src=src,
data=data,
hex_bytes=hex_bytes,
chunk_size=chunk_size,
data_length_byte_size=4,
zero=zero
)
count += 1
if count % 1000 == 0:
print(f"- Processed {count} messages.")
if queue_message is not None:
if queue_name is None:
raise Exception("ERROR [3], QUEUE NAME NOT FOUND FOR QUEUE MESSAGE")
if (not queue) and (not output_file):
print(f"queue_name:\n{queue_name}\n")
print(f"queue_message:\n{queue_message}")
print("\n\n=====================================================================================\n\n")
else:
if queue:
queue.create_queue(queue_name)
json.loads(queue_message)
queue.publish_to_queue(queue_name, queue_message)
if output_file:
save_data(output_file, queue_name, queue_message)
queue_name = None
queue_message = None
if message_limit != 0 and message_limit <= count:
sys.exit()
else:
data = read_chunk(src,src.tell(), chunk_size)
if debug:
print("[*] position: %d" % (src.tell()))
print(f"- Processed {count} messages.")
print(f"Finish processing {count} messages from {file_path}.\n")
if delete_file:
print(f"...Delete file '{file_path}'...\n")
os.remove(file_path)
def read_file(file_path, chunk):
if os.path.exists(file_path):
src = open(file_path, 'rb')
# if the file is smaller than our chunksize, reset.
chunk_size = min(os.path.getsize(file_path), chunk)
else:
sys.stderr.write(f"Cannot find the specified file '{file_path}'\n")
sys.exit()
return src, chunk_size
if __name__ == '__main__':
# search a rabbit mq rdq file for
# potential amqp records:
# by finding: 395f316c000000016d0000 , parsing the next 2 bytes as
# record length and outputing the record to stdout
#
parser = ArgumentParser(description="Process RabbitMQ persistent file storage (.rdq) and output to file or another RabbitMQ")
parser.add_argument("-b", dest='bytes', default=16, type=int, help="number of bytes to show per line")
parser.add_argument("-s", dest='start', default=0, type=int, help="starting byte")
parser.add_argument("-l", dest='length', default=16, type=int, help="length in bytes to dump")
parser.add_argument("-r", dest='chunk', default=1024, type=int, help="length in bytes to read at a time")
parser.add_argument("-i", dest='input', default=None, help="input: filename")
parser.add_argument("-f", "--folder", dest='folder', default=None, help="input: folder path")
parser.add_argument("-t", dest='text', default='', help="text string to search for")
# output related arguments
parser.add_argument("-o", dest='output', help="output: filename")
parser.add_argument("-q", dest='queue', help="config containing output queue credential")
parser.add_argument("--delete", action='store_true', dest='delete', default=False, help="input: folder path")
# this hex value worked for me, might work for you
# to delimit the entries in a rabbitmq .rdq file
parser.add_argument("-x", "--msg-hex", dest='hex', default="395f316c000000016d,395f316c000000026d,00046E6F6E656400046E6F6E656C000000016D", help="hex string to search for queue message")
parser.add_argument("--hex_queue", dest='hex_queue', default="65786368616E67656D000000006C000000016D000000,000865786368616E67656D000000", help="hex string to search for queue name")
parser.add_argument("-c", dest='count', default=1, type=int, help="count of hits to find before stopping (0 for don't stop)")
# debug related arguments
parser.add_argument("--dev", action='store_true', dest='dev_debug', default=False, help="Print debug message related to development process")
parser.add_argument("-d", "--debug", action='store_true', dest='debug', default=False, help="turn on debugging output")
parser.add_argument("-z", "--zero", action='store_true', dest='zero', default=False, help="when printing output, count from zero rather than position hit was found")
options = parser.parse_args()
if options.input is None and options.folder is None:
sys.stderr.write("No input file (-i) or folder (-f) specified\n")
sys.exit()
if options.input is not None and options.folder is not None:
sys.stderr.write("Please specify only either input file (-i) or folder (-f)\n")
sys.exit()
output_file = None
if options.output is not None:
output_file = options.output
queue = None
if options.queue is not None:
with open(f'config/{options.queue}') as stream:
queue_config = yaml.safe_load(stream)['queue']
queue = RabbitMQ(queue_config['user'], queue_config['password'], queue_config['host'], queue_config['port'])
queue.connect_to_queue()
queue_name_indicator_hex = options.hex_queue.split(',')
queue_message_indicator_hex = options.hex.split(',')
if options.input:
file_path = options.input
restore_rdq_data(
file_path=file_path,
queue_name_indicator_hex=queue_name_indicator_hex,
queue_message_indicator_hex=queue_message_indicator_hex,
chunk=options.chunk,
message_limit=options.count,
output_file=output_file,
queue=queue,
start_bytes=options.start,
delete_file=options.delete,
debug=options.debug,
dev_debug=options.dev_debug
)
elif options.folder:
folder_path = options.folder.rstrip('/')
if os.path.exists(folder_path):
rdq_list = list(filter(lambda file_name: file_name.endswith('.rdq'), os.listdir(folder_path)))
total_file_count = len(rdq_list)
processed_file_count = 0
for rdq_file in rdq_list:
full_path = f"{folder_path}/{rdq_file}"
restore_rdq_data(
file_path=full_path,
queue_name_indicator_hex=queue_name_indicator_hex,
queue_message_indicator_hex=queue_message_indicator_hex,
chunk=options.chunk,
message_limit=options.count,
output_file=output_file,
queue=queue,
start_bytes=0,
delete_file=options.delete,
debug=options.debug,
dev_debug=options.dev_debug
)
processed_file_count += 1
print(f"Processed {processed_file_count}/{total_file_count} files.\n")
else:
sys.stderr.write(f"Cannot find the specified folder '{folder_path}'\n")
